ABOUT THE ROLE

The QA Technician has a responsibility to ensure quality, safety and the legality of the product are achieved to the highest standard. This is achieved through various online checks. Non-conforming product is brought to the attention of the QA Supervisor so that a suitable course of corrective action can be implemented

KEY DUTIES

  • Carry out routine metal and gas checks as per procedure on (Min hourly) and completing the relevant process control documentation
  • Daily calibration checks of on-line checkweighers to ensure they are operating correctly.
  • Quality attribute assessments on finished product to the defined attributes and a specified frequency
  • Label checks (Start Up & Product Changeover Line Check Record)
  • To monitor, record and collate mean weights
  • Monitor hygiene practice throughout the facility
  • Place product on hold when necessary
  • Raise non-conformances for out of specification product & issuing corrective action & following up
  • Gathering taste panel samples – to the set sampling schedule for start and end of life sampling.
  • Monitor & police the control of allergens from intake to despatch and to carry out allergen line swabs as requested
  • To ensure factory rules are being adhered to by all CFF & agency colleagues at all times
